Factors to Consider When Choosing Foldable Monocrystalline Solar Panels

When choosing foldable monocrystalline panels, start by comparing Foldable Panel Efficiency and Power Output Capacity to ensure the model meets your energy needs. Consider MPPT Benefits for better charging efficiency in variable conditions, and evaluate Weather Resilience to know how it performs in wind, rain, or heat. Finally, weigh Portability Benefits for setup and transport, and choose a package that balances weight, size, and reliability for your typical use cases.
Foldable Panel Efficiency
Foldable panel efficiency matters because stronger efficiency means more usable power in a compact size. You assess efficiency ratings around 22–25% for foldable monocrystalline panels, with many models showing 23–23.5% under standard test conditions. Compare how upgraded mono cells and reduced mismatch loss boost peak conversions in portable designs. Look for panels that cite 23.0–23.5% and note minor variations caused by manufacturing tolerances and testing conditions. Understand that higher efficiency directly benefits portable setups by delivering more power from a smaller folded area. Check factors that influence published figures, including cell type, backsheet or laminate material (ETFE), and real‑world conditions such as angle, temperature, and shading. Use these data to select a model offering consistent performance across typical field conditions.
Power Output Capacity
Power output capacity is a key factor when selecting foldable monocrystalline panels. You’ll see rated outputs from about 100W to 400W, giving you scalable power for different off-grid needs. Higher wattage means more energy in the same sun, but you may need compatible charge controllers and power stations with adequate input capacity. Peak power (Pmax) comes under standard test conditions; real-world output drops with angle, temperature, shading, and cable runs. Some 200W–400W panels use MPPT or PWM controllers to optimize charging efficiency and maximize usable power to batteries or devices. Panel efficiency, often 22–25% for monocrystalline, affects space required to reach target wattage in portable foldable designs. Consider your available space and desired daily energy when choosing wattage.
MPPT Benefits
MPPT offers clear benefits for foldable monocrystalline panels. You gain more real-world power when sun angles shift or temperatures change, so run tests under different conditions to verify output. MPPT optimizes the load to harvest maximum power, especially when open-circuit voltage is higher than your charging voltage. Use panels with MPPT to see higher efficiency and less wasted energy in inconsistent lighting or partial shade. MPPT controllers enable higher voltage input, charging storage devices more efficiently and reducing current and heat losses along cables. Pair a foldable panel with MPPT to maintain stable charging curves and improve response during rapid sun changes. Check that the controller matches your panel’s voltage range and your battery’s charging needs.
Weather Resilience
Weather resilience matters because weather exposure affects performance and longevity. When evaluating foldable panels, check IP rating: IP65 blocks dust and water jets, IP68 allows immersion under tested conditions, ensuring better outdoor durability. Look for weather-sealed construction with laminated ETFE or fiberglass layers and sealed junction boxes to reduce water ingress and resist UV exposure. Confirm temperature tolerance ranges from about -10°C to 65°C, with optimal performance near 25°C, to stay reliable across climates. Inspect outdoor durability features such as rugged surface coatings and reinforced grommets or mounting hardware to withstand wind, rain, and handling during setup. Verify protection for electronics with weather-resistant enclosures and UV-stable casings to maintain safe charging in adverse weather.

Connection Versatility
Connection versatility matters because you want a panel that works with your existing gear without extra adapters. Look for panels with multiple connectivity options and adapters, such as MC4 outputs plus XT60, DC5521/5525/7909, and similar plugs. This expands compatibility with power stations and DC devices you already own. Check the cable length; an 8-to-9-foot MC4 run (about 3 meters) offers flexible placement and reduces the need for extensions. Consider 8-in-1 MC4 connector sets and extra DC adapters to cover various ecosystems and input tolerances. Ensure the panel includes USB-C PD, USB-A, or multiple DC ports (for example 5V/3A or 18V DC) to support direct device charging. Verify the panel delivers rated output without exceeding a station’s input limits, especially for 40V–48V panels.
